This report critically examines the implications of recent tariff adjustments and international strategic countermeasures on Multimode Low-Loss MPO competitive dynamics, regional economic interdependencies, and supply chain reconfigurations.The multimode low-loss MPO is a high-performance fiber optic connector based on multi-core fiber connection technology, primarily designed for high-speed, high-density transmission of multi-channel parallel optical signals. Its structure consists of a multi-core fiber endface (typically 12, 24, or more fibers), a high-precision MT ferrule, and alignment guide pins. Through precise mechanical fit, it achieves an optical connection with low insertion loss and high return loss. Compared to traditional MPO connectors, the multimode low-loss MPO features optimized manufacturing processes, endface polishing, guide accuracy, and ferrule materials, resulting in an insertion loss typically below 0.35 dB, meeting the bandwidth and signal integrity requirements of 40G, 100G, and even 400G data centers, optical communication systems, and high-performance computing networks. It is widely used in data center backbone cables, parallel optical module interconnects, fiber distribution frames, and high-density cabinet cabling. Its high stability, low energy consumption, and ease of expansion make it a key foundational component for high-speed multimode fiber interconnects. The upstream suppliers of multimode, low-loss MPO connectors primarily include optical fiber manufacturers, MT ferrule manufacturers, suppliers of precision ceramic and plastic guide pins, and manufacturers of end-face polishing and coating materials. These suppliers provide multi-core optical fibers, core connector components, and precision materials, which determine the optical performance and stability of MPO connectors. The downstream suppliers include end users and system integrators, such as data center operators, high-performance computing networks, telecommunications operators, enterprise campus network construction, cloud computing, and fiber optic distribution frame manufacturers. These end users require low-insertion-loss, multi-channel, high-density interconnect solutions to support high-speed data transmission and network expansion. Due to the maturity of multimode, low-loss MPO technology, standardized production, and high added value, the industry's gross profit margin is generally high, typically around 38%.In 2024, global production of multimode, low-loss MPO connectors is expected to reach 11.73 million units, with an average selling price of US$13 per unit. The annual production capacity of single-line multimode, low-loss MPO connectors is 360,000 units.As a key component for high-density, multi-channel fiber optic interconnects, multimode, low-loss MPOs are becoming an essential infrastructure component for data centers, cloud computing, enterprise networks, and high-performance computing (HPC). With the rapid growth of data center bandwidth demands and the widespread adoption of 40G/100G/400G parallel optical modules, multimode, low-loss MPOs, with their low insertion loss, high density, ease of deployment, and simplified maintenance, are playing a key role in short-distance, high-density interconnect scenarios. Furthermore, the development of multimode, low-loss MPO technology has promoted the standardization and modularization of fiber cabling, as well as the upgrading of efficient cabling solutions within cabinets, significantly improving network construction efficiency and overall operational reliability. Although limited in long-distance transmission and high-speed expansion compared to single-mode, low-loss MPOs, multimode, low-loss MPOs continue to maintain strong demand in applications such as internal data center interconnects, server rack docking, and parallel optical module interchangeability. With the widespread adoption of high-bandwidth multimode fibers such as OM4 and OM5, and the optimization of low-loss design processes, their market share in the high-density interconnect market is expected to steadily grow, making them a key solution for meeting future high-speed, short-distance optical communication needs.
The global Multimode Low-Loss MPO market size was estimated at USD 152.0 million in 2025 and is projected to grow at a compound annual growth rate (CAGR) of 9.20% during the forecast period.
